What does 普 mean in Japanese?
普 means universal, wide(ly), generally, Prussia.
How do you read 普?
On'yomi: フ (FU). Kun'yomi: あまね.く、あまねし (amaneku, amaneshi).
How many strokes does 普 have?
普 has 12 strokes. Its radical is 日 (sun).
